Oche Peter, professionally known as Young Oche, is a budding Nigerian Singer and Songwriter. He is one of the winners of the Next Up Online Talent Search and a member of the boy band T – Boiz set up by the music legend 2 Baba
Young Oche is a talented young musician; a versatile Afrobeats/ Afro Fusion Singer, Songwriter and Producer. He describes his genre of music as Afro Spirit – a blend of afrobeats, rhythm and soul with emotional vibes. Little wonder his mentor is 2baba and his role models are P square, Wande Coal and Wizkid
According to Oche, music is innate. Having had and overcome some struggles early in life, Oche has mastered the art of garnering inspiration from within. He creates unique sounds from situations and virtually everything he sees or listens to.
Young Oche started his professional music journey when he dropped his debut single “Tango” in 2017 which introduced him as a household name within the community.
However, Oche would find his big break working alongside the legendary Nigerian singer Innocent Idibia popularly known as 2baba. In 2019, Oche won the #NextUp online challenge and became a member of the boy band T-boiz created by 2Baba. This has enhanced his musical career immensely

Same year, 2019, Young Oche acted as the opening act for Campari Make It Red Festival Abuja, featured on 2Baba Live: 20 Years A King’s Concert in Abuja & Lagos, and also performed at the AFRIMA Music Village.
Here’s Young Oche’s discography –
Tango – 2017 , Supper – 2017 , Anyhow – 2018 , High – 2019
Promise – 2020 and the latest song FDS (Forever Don Start) which has recorded good numbers on many streaming platforms since its release in March, 2021.
Young Oche has written all of his songs and has worked with notable Nigerian Producers like Rexxie, Masterkraft and Popito.
